The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Charles Edwards, born in 1809 in Wonersh, Surrey, consisted of 3 members. Charles was the head of the household, widower. He had 1 child; Ellen, born 1851 in Wonersh, Surrey, England.
During the period, also present in the household was Charles's Lodger, George Stenning, born in 1839 in Tillington, Sussex, England.
